Okay, but in retrospective, that moment where All Might reads a script on his first class that's used for comedic purposes and his kinda clumsy personality actually says good things of him as a teacher:
1. He planned and scheduled the class: all teachers should do that. You can't just show up without a planned class to, well, classes. You have to plan the topic, how to teach it, strategies, activities an all that. I know that because I'm studying to be a teacher and we get told that at least once in every teaching-related subject.
2. He knew he could have trouble remembering the explanation for the dynamic from the top of his head and brought a script in case he needed it: he's aware of his own shortcomings and not only not so prideful as to be ashamed of them, but will also search ways to compensate them. This is just common sense but no one wants a teacher who puts their pride over acknowledging their flaws/limits. That's how teachers who think they're always right are.
3. His plan wasn't that bad and could have been more useful if there was more reflection afterwards or theory to back up the experience: There are learning theories that are based on having the students experience things and then reflect on what they just went through. The theory side was weak but he did asked the students their own thoughts on the matches. He should have inquired more and ask to other students too (you know, not only have Momo answer everything). The exercise itself could have worked well as a diagnostic activity. Also, estimulating the students to think is a good thing.
Now, on his fails:
1. He should have set better limits at the start of the activity. I don't remember if he didn't, but if he did, he should have put his foot down on not letting the very dangerous lethal attack go on. Not just tell Bakugou not to use it, but also stop the activity and, well, physically stop him. Not "but Izuku could learn from this". He is his highschool teacher, the physical well-being should be prioritized about a dubioud dangerous "learning" opportunity. Not "but he is just a teacher. Stopping a student with a bomb isn't his job". It's a fictional world with heroes and he is a hero. He is the hero. He could and he should. "But he can't use violence against his students, right?" No, he can't. But he could just, you know, pull Bakugou from the collar take off his guantlet, for example.
2. Again, a better reflection/theory afterwards. I mean, yeah, time limit, but he could have just told them to come up with three things well done and badly done from the overall matches for the next class. Would have make them to think more on strategies and procedures for future activities/hero work.
3. He should have informed that one of his students tried to kill another. Not if he dodges, my ass. That's like, a crime. That's at least assault, sir. They have permission to spare with quirks, not to try to kill or maim each other.
That's about it, I think? I haven't watched BNHA in ages but he's not as bad of a teacher as I remembered. He's just a rookie teacher who should learn to give better advice.

(ftr, a perfume’s top notes are the initial scents you smell on application, and are usually the lightest or sharpest scents used (e.g. citrus or super powdery/light florals); middle notes are the scents that appear once the top note scents have faded, and can be considered the central core or heart of the perfume - they’re usually fuller and smoother than top notes (think cinnamon/other spices, or fuller floral scents like jasmine); and the base notes form the foundational structure of the perfume, underpinning the top and middle notes and generally being the most long-lived scents that linger after application (usually woody scents, or musks). accords are blends of notes that form the character profile of a perfume (e.g. woody or floral).)
órpheon, the perfume i've seen re: yunho a couple of times now, has a scent profile as follows (according to fragrantica dot com anyway, since i unfortunately don't have a bottle on hand):
top note - juniper berries
middle note - jasmine 
base notes - cedar, tonka bean, powdery notes
accords - powdery, woody, aromatic, fresh spicy, white floral
órpheon’s description states that it’s intended to be used by anyone rather than being specifically masculine or feminine, and this is shown through the mix of scents used - the powdery base notes are more traditionally found in feminine fragrances, and white floral accords are also probably more associated with femininity, but jasmine is quite a powerful scent as far as florals go, and the spicy top note and soft woody base notes also push back towards a more unisex or even borderline masculine scent. 
in my opinion, regardless of who wears it, this is a scent profile that immediately states power. there’s a strong, robust sensuality that runs through the entire perfume, and a richness that calls for a certain kind of presence - it evokes a quiet but dominating confidence without being aggressive, as the spicy top note gives way to smooth middle and base notes that paint an image of refinement and class. 
juniper berry creates a tangy, sharp top note. generally, in feminine perfumes, a top note will be something light and fresh while still being quite soft, like rose or many something like lemon for a bit of extra pep, but juniper berry is peppery, spicy, and particularly crisp. imo it’s refreshing, and that freshness lends to a lot of people likening it to gin or pine, but it’s apparently particularly notable in orphéon and can be almost borderline-overwhelming for some people. it’s got a bite that a lot of top notes don’t tend to have - it’s not a small scent, and i think you need a lot of presence to wear a perfume with a heavy juniper top note. it’s by no means a flimsy scent. 
generally, if your top note is as solid as orphéon’s, you’re going to need strong middle/base notes. jasmine is a floral scent, but imo it can’t be compared to other floral scents like lavender or rose because it’s very full-bodied and rich. once the initial punch of juniper berry fades, jasmine provides a smooth aftertaste. it’s sweet, but not like traditional light sugary scents - it’s opulent and fruity, more akin to honey. jasmine usually adds strength to lighter-smelling perfumes to give them a longer-lasting core because it’s a powerful scent on its own, but it’s not too heavy and projects elegance and sophistication. jasmine’s also quite musky as far as a floral scent goes, which adds a bit of animalistic masculinity without being traditionally overtly masculine. i’m not sure how strong the jasmine is in órpheon specifically, but in higher amounts, it can be quite a divisive scent - like juniper berries, it can be too much for some people because of the power it carries.
cedar and tonka bean form the core of the woody accord that mostly characterises this perfume. like jasmine, tonka bean is sweet, but it’s another full-bodied sweet scent rather than something light and airy. it’s also more on the masculine end of unisex imo. it’s sweet in the way cherry and almond cake is sweet, rather than in the way strawberry-flavoured sweets are sweet. tonka bean is also what the perfume relies on to add complexity to its profile, because tonka bean is a lot of things at once - sweet, but also spicy, and herby/green, and nutty. it’s a warm and exotic scent, tends to bring other scents together well due to its smoothness, and lends to the sensuality of órpheon’s scent profile as a whole. 
i miiiiiight be biased since cedar is one of my favourite notes, but that's because it’s soft without being insignificant, and is versatile enough to fit anywhere in a fragrance - top, middle, or base note. to me, it’s a robust, androgynous, sexy scent, and provides depth and sensuality to pretty much any perfume it’s added to. cedar’s also pretty dry-smelling and earthy, which works well when braced against sweeter scents like jasmine and tonka bean that tend to stick in the mouth. i usually like perfumes that contain cedar as a middle or base note and then an airy floral top note like rose, because the cedar balances out the floral accord, but combined with the above notes, it’s a strong foundation for a strong scent. the powdery notes in the base are likely there purely to provide some breathing space and lightness to what’s otherwise an incredibly intense, thick, full-bodied perfume. 
tl;dr órpheon's scent profile is delightfully androgynous and incredibly strength, rich, and sensual without feeling hyper-aggressive. it can probably be overpowering for a lot of people, but i think if you have the confidence and aura to wear it, it adds to a person's sophisticated, elegant power. which, you know, i think is pretty fitting for yunho :P
